    The structure of the women’s game isn’t great, there is disparity in most of the leagues which are hard to get out of as often only one gets promoted. So you can have 3-4 ambitious teams in a low league like forest, who are investing in the women’s game and to get promoted yet when some inevitably miss out on promotion it just makes things daft the following season.

    Needs an overhaul really.

    Yes and what you have now are pro/semi pro clubs stuck down the pyramid struggling to get through the system due to lack of promotions. And then you have teams in the super league who struggle each year but are never in any real danger of relegation due to their always being a proper shit team taking up the sole relegation place. (Leicester have won 13 games out of 66 in the past three years, but have never really been at risk of relegation).
